Definition of Sark from the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

Sark

 
/sɑːk/
 
/sɑːrk/
jump to other results
  1. a part of the British Channel Islands, consisting of two islands, Great Sark and Little Sark, which are joined by a narrow strip of land. Sark has its own parliament, and a leader called the Seigneur (if a man) or the Dame (if a woman), who passes the title on to his or her children. The islands are popular with tourists.
